Washington County Hospital and Clinics welcomes Pulmonology Provider, Nicole Alsaker, ARNP
By Greta Clemons, WCHC
Jan. 20, 2026 11:36 am
Southeast Iowa Union offers audio versions of articles using Instaread. Some words may be mispronounced.
Washington — Washington County Hospital and Clinics (WCHC) is pleased to announce the addition of Nicole Alsaker, ARNP, as a pulmonology provider joining Dr. Andrew Ashby in expanding specialty care services for the community.
Nicole is a board-certified Adult Gerontology Acute Care Nurse Practitioner and brings years of clinical experience in pulmonology and sleep medicine, along with a strong background in acute care. Most recently, she served as a Pulmonology and Sleep Nurse Practitioner at Mercy Hospital in Iowa City and University of Iowa Downtown Campus, where she supported patients through comprehensive evaluation, treatment planning, and long-term care management.
Nicole was recently recognized at University of Iowa Health Care for her patient-centered approach, ranking in the top 10% nationally for patient experience scores.
“We are excited to welcome Nicole to our specialty care team,” said Todd Patterson, CEO of Washington County Hospital and Clinics. “Her experience and dedication to patient-centered care will help strengthen our pulmonology services and increase access for patients in our region.”
Nicole will see patients beginning Jan. 30, in the Ken and Rosemary Hanson Specialty Clinic, located at Entrance 8 at Washington County Hospital and Clinics.
Patients can access pulmonology services through referral from their health care provider. For more information or to schedule an appointment, please call 319-863-3936
